Origi is a decent player, but he has never played regularly during his Liverpool career and only occasionally plays more than just a few minutes per game. I think he's only started 11 league games for them since 2017. To expect him to step up to be a regular first choice 90 minute player in a few weeks time would be a huge ask. 25/30 million pounds is a big price to pay for a striker who has been a perennial bench warmer and an occasional part time striker.
